Xueyi: The Quantum Destroyer

Xueyi remains a solid choice for Quantum Break teams, despite being overshadowed by newer 5-stars. What makes her stand out is her unique ability to bypass enemy Toughness entirely, allowing her to trigger Quantum Break effects against literally any enemy type. That's pretty poggers for certain content!

As someone who's invested heavily in Xueyi, I can tell you she's definitely viable, but she does come with some caveats:

  • Pros:

  • Universal Quantum Break application

  • Flexible build paths (Crit or Break DMG)

  • Strong Follow-up attack synergy

  • Cons:

  • High investment ceiling

  • Needs dedicated team support

  • Outclassed by limited 5-stars in raw numbers

My personal experience with Xueyi? She's a beast in niche content where her Quantum Break shines, but she demands a team built specifically around her to truly pop off. If you're F2P or a low spender, she's definitely worth considering, but whales will likely gravitate toward the premium options.

Rappa: The Imaginary Imprisoner

Rappa continues to be one of my favorite units in 2025, especially after the Imaginary buffs in patch 3.8. Her ability to consistently trigger Imprisonment across multiple enemies is straight-up broken in certain content.

What makes Rappa so clutch is how she combines utility with respectable damage:

  • Pros:

  • AoE Imprisonment is S-tier crowd control

  • Works against virtually all enemy types

  • Excellent in Pure Fiction and Memory of Chaos

  • Cons:

  • Imaginary Break DMG has inherently lower multipliers

  • More of a utility/sub-DPS than a primary damage dealer

  • Requires specific team comps to maximize potential

The recent updates have been kind to Rappa, with several indirect buffs through new support units and Light Cones. She's aging like fine wine and remains a solid pull even in 2025's meta.

Boothill: The Single-Target Specialist

When it comes to deleting bosses, few can match Boothill's raw power. This Physical Hunt unit is the definition of a glass cannon - he'll obliterate anything in his path, provided you can keep him alive.

Boothill excels in:

  • Apocalyptic Shadow (absolutely dominates here)

  • Weekly boss fights

  • Any single-target focused content

However, he falls off hard in:

  • Pure Fiction (too many waves of enemies)

  • Content requiring AoE damage

I've been using Boothill since his release, and he's still my go-to for any boss-killing content. His ability to apply Physical weakness while simultaneously breaking Toughness creates a devastating damage loop that few units can match. If you're struggling with Apocalyptic Shadow, Boothill is your answer.

Firefly: The Queen of Break DMG

No cap - Firefly is literally built different. After the recent buffs in version 3.9, she's undoubtedly the most cracked Break DPS in the entire game. When properly supported, her damage ceiling is virtually unlimited.

The catch? She's extremely team-dependent. To unlock Firefly's true potential, you need:

  1. Harmony Trailblazer (mandatory)

  2. Ruan Mei (nearly mandatory)

  3. A flexible fourth slot (often a Break-focused support)

When these conditions are met, Firefly becomes an absolute monster. Her ability to rapidly break Toughness and then capitalize on it with massive Super Break DMG makes her viable in literally every game mode.
